.photoGrid_spinner__2OtqJ{display:inline-block;width:40px;height:40px;border-radius:50%;border:4px solid rgba(0,0,0,.1);border-top-color:#fc5f12;animation:photoGrid_spin__nNv8u 1s ease-in-out infinite}.photoGrid_spinner-sm__NAN_k{width:20px;height:20px;border-width:2px}.photoGrid_spinner-lg__aPKF_{width:60px;height:60px;border-width:6px}.photoGrid_spinner-primary__PwFZu{border-top-color:#fc5f12}.photoGrid_spinner-success__iy6DY{border-top-color:#4caf50}.photoGrid_spinner-danger__qWvYZ{border-top-color:#e74c3c}.photoGrid_spinner-dark__X7PT4{border-top-color:#444}.photoGrid_spinner-custom__haT7L{border-top-color:var(--spinner-color,#fc5f12)}.photoGrid_gridItem__7dQ4P .photoGrid_photoContainer__KGuKd{position:relative;width:100%;overflow:hidden}.photoGrid_gridItem__7dQ4P .photoGrid_hiddenImage__mgrXQ,.photoGrid_gridItem__7dQ4P .photoGrid_visibleImage__1awqv{object-fit:cover;width:100%;height:100%}.photoGrid_gridItem__7dQ4P .photoGrid_authorDetails__1OnLn{display:flex;margin-left:12px;margin-bottom:12px;margin-top:10px}.photoGrid_gridItem__7dQ4P .photoGrid_nameContainer__9ttgG{font-size:10px;margin-left:6px}.photoGrid_gridItem__7dQ4P .photoGrid_btnContainerUnderPhoto__h9piH{margin-left:12px;margin-top:12px}.photoGrid_gridItem__7dQ4P .photoGrid_btnContainerUnderPhoto__h9piH .photoGrid_btnContent__mj0s1{align-items:center;display:flex;font-weight:400}.photoGrid_gridItem__7dQ4P .photoGrid_btnContainerUnderPhoto__h9piH .photoGrid_btn__pa6tA{border:1px solid #d1d1d1;margin-right:10px;padding:5px 9px;position:relative}.photoGrid_gridItem__7dQ4P .photoGrid_btnContainerUnderPhoto__h9piH .photoGrid_btn__pa6tA.photoGrid_loading__gQbS6{position:relative}.photoGrid_gridItem__7dQ4P .photoGrid_btnContainerUnderPhoto__h9piH .photoGrid_btn__pa6tA.photoGrid_loading__gQbS6 .photoGrid_btnContent__mj0s1{opacity:0}.photoGrid_gridItem__7dQ4P .photoGrid_btnContainerUnderPhoto__h9piH .photoGrid_btn__pa6tA.photoGrid_loading__gQbS6:after{content:"";position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);width:12px;height:12px;border-radius:50%;border:2px solid #000;border-top-color:rgba(0,0,0,0);animation:photoGrid_spin__nNv8u 1s linear infinite}.photoGrid_gridItem__7dQ4P .photoGrid_image__J9_oD{object-fit:cover}.photoGrid_gridItem__7dQ4P .photoGrid_priceContainer__MNWMA{display:none;position:absolute}.photoGrid_gridItem__7dQ4P .photoGrid_shadow__aD4h6{display:none}.photoGrid_gridItem__7dQ4P .photoGrid_iconSelected__Kx3HD{padding:10px;position:absolute;top:0}.photoGrid_gridItem__7dQ4P .photoGrid_btnContainer__1NrKd,.photoGrid_gridItem__7dQ4P .photoGrid_btnContainer__1NrKd .photoGrid_btnText__Iyi8V{display:none}.photoGrid_gridItem__7dQ4P.photoGrid_successPayment__dfAFF .photoGrid_btnContainer__1NrKd{display:block;position:absolute;top:0;right:0;padding:10px}.photoGrid_gridItem__7dQ4P.photoGrid_successPayment__dfAFF .photoGrid_btnContainer__1NrKd .photoGrid_btn__pa6tA{padding:8px 12px;margin-right:10px;position:relative}.photoGrid_gridItem__7dQ4P.photoGrid_successPayment__dfAFF .photoGrid_btnContainer__1NrKd .photoGrid_btn__pa6tA.photoGrid_loading__gQbS6{position:relative}.photoGrid_gridItem__7dQ4P.photoGrid_successPayment__dfAFF .photoGrid_btnContainer__1NrKd .photoGrid_btn__pa6tA.photoGrid_loading__gQbS6 .photoGrid_btnContent__mj0s1{opacity:0}.photoGrid_gridItem__7dQ4P.photoGrid_successPayment__dfAFF .photoGrid_btnContainer__1NrKd .photoGrid_btn__pa6tA.photoGrid_loading__gQbS6:after{content:"";position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);width:12px;height:12px;border-radius:50%;border:2px solid #000;border-top-color:rgba(0,0,0,0);animation:photoGrid_spin__nNv8u 1s linear infinite}@keyframes photoGrid_spin__nNv8u{0%{transform:translate(-50%,-50%) rotate(0deg)}to{transform:translate(-50%,-50%) rotate(1turn)}}.photoGrid_gridItem__7dQ4P.photoGrid_successPayment__dfAFF .photoGrid_btnContainer__1NrKd .photoGrid_btnContent__mj0s1{display:flex;align-items:center}@media(min-width:768px){.photoGrid_gridItem__7dQ4P .photoGrid_btnContainer__1NrKd{padding:20px;display:none}.photoGrid_gridItem__7dQ4P .photoGrid_btnContainer__1NrKd .photoGrid_btn__pa6tA{padding:10px;margin-right:10px;position:relative}.photoGrid_gridItem__7dQ4P .photoGrid_btnContainer__1NrKd .photoGrid_btn__pa6tA.photoGrid_loading__gQbS6{position:relative}.photoGrid_gridItem__7dQ4P .photoGrid_btnContainer__1NrKd .photoGrid_btn__pa6tA.photoGrid_loading__gQbS6 .photoGrid_btnContent__mj0s1{opacity:0}.photoGrid_gridItem__7dQ4P .photoGrid_btnContainer__1NrKd .photoGrid_btn__pa6tA.photoGrid_loading__gQbS6:after{content:"";position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);width:12px;height:12px;border-radius:50%;border:2px solid #000;border-top-color:rgba(0,0,0,0);animation:photoGrid_spin__nNv8u 1s linear infinite}@keyframes photoGrid_spin__nNv8u{0%{transform:translate(-50%,-50%) rotate(0deg)}to{transform:translate(-50%,-50%) rotate(1turn)}}.photoGrid_gridItem__7dQ4P .photoGrid_btnContainer__1NrKd .photoGrid_btnContent__mj0s1{display:flex}.photoGrid_gridItem__7dQ4P .photoGrid_btnContainerUnderPhoto__h9piH .photoGrid_btnContent__mj0s1 .photoGrid_btnIcon__ntOkJ{margin-right:10px}.photoGrid_gridItem__7dQ4P:hover .photoGrid_btnContainer__1NrKd{display:block;position:absolute;top:0;right:0}.photoGrid_gridItem__7dQ4P:hover.photoGrid_maximized__L4eKA .photoGrid_btnContainer__1NrKd{display:none}.photoGrid_gridItem__7dQ4P .photoGrid_iconSelected__Kx3HD{padding:20px}.photoGrid_gridItem__7dQ4P .photoGrid_icon__k7Ndq{height:50px;width:50px}}.photoGrid_maximized__L4eKA{margin:40px auto}.photoGrid_maximized__L4eKA .photoGrid_gridController__TP6HX{cursor:zoom-out}@media(min-width:768px){.photoGrid_gridItem__7dQ4P:hover .photoGrid_priceContainer__MNWMA,.photoGrid_maximized__L4eKA .photoGrid_priceContainer__MNWMA{bottom:20px;color:#fff;display:block;font-size:18px;font-weight:700;left:20px;position:absolute}.photoGrid_gridItem__7dQ4P:hover .photoGrid_shadow__aD4h6,.photoGrid_maximized__L4eKA .photoGrid_shadow__aD4h6{display:block;background-image:linear-gradient(rgba(0,0,0,.3411764706),rgba(0,0,0,.337254902) 3.5%,rgba(0,0,0,.3254901961) 7%,rgba(0,0,0,.3058823529) 10.35%,rgba(0,0,0,.2862745098) 13.85%,rgba(0,0,0,.262745098) 17.35%,rgba(0,0,0,.2352941176) 20.85%,rgba(0,0,0,.2117647059) 24.35%,rgba(0,0,0,.1882352941) 27.85%,rgba(0,0,0,.1647058824) 31.35%,rgba(0,0,0,.1450980392) 34.85%,rgba(0,0,0,.1254901961) 38.35%,rgba(0,0,0,.1137254902) 41.85%,rgba(0,0,0,.1019607843) 45.35% 48.85%,rgba(0,0,0,.1019607843) 52.35%,rgba(0,0,0,.1137254902) 55.85%,rgba(0,0,0,.1254901961) 59.35%,rgba(0,0,0,.1450980392) 62.85%,rgba(0,0,0,.1647058824) 66.35%,rgba(0,0,0,.1882352941) 69.85%,rgba(0,0,0,.2117647059) 73.35%,rgba(0,0,0,.2352941176) 76.85%,rgba(0,0,0,.262745098) 80.35%,rgba(0,0,0,.2862745098) 83.85%,rgba(0,0,0,.3058823529) 87.35%,rgba(0,0,0,.3254901961) 90.85%,rgba(0,0,0,.337254902) 94.35%,rgba(0,0,0,.3450980392) 97.85%,rgba(0,0,0,.3490196078));position:absolute;inset:0}}.photoGrid_gridController__TP6HX{color:rgba(0,0,0,0);cursor:zoom-in;background-color:rgba(0,0,0,0);border:none;position:absolute;height:100%;top:0;width:100%}.photoGrid_skeleton__SoooW{width:100%;height:200px;background:linear-gradient(90deg,rgba(0,0,0,.06) 25%,rgba(0,0,0,.12) 37%,rgba(0,0,0,.06) 63%);background-size:400% 100%;animation:photoGrid_skeletonLoading__O0Erl 1.4s ease infinite}@keyframes photoGrid_skeletonLoading__O0Erl{0%{background-position:100% 50%}to{background-position:0 50%}}.photoGrid_hiddenImage__mgrXQ{display:none}.photoGrid_visibleImage__1awqv{display:block}